Commit graph

14 commits

Author SHA1 Message Date
Xu Liu
393280b02c Merge branch 'dev' into feat/cursor 2022-03-20 17:58:04 +08:00
Xu Liu
91a4b5a318 fix: 修复光标反色问题 2022-03-10 18:00:39 +08:00
刘旭
335c60e435 refactor: 简化纹理创建 2022-03-09 13:56:23 +08:00
刘旭
8aab238150 fix: 部分 B8G8R8A8_UNORM 改为 R8G8B8A8_UNORM,因为前者在一些硬件上不支持 UAV 2022-03-09 12:49:03 +08:00
刘旭
0913118486 fix: 微小优化 2022-02-25 10:36:39 +08:00
刘旭
d014c3a589 feat: 处理主窗口或源窗口被遮挡的情况 2022-02-25 10:27:17 +08:00
Xu Liu
6b6bf36ae3 fix: 优化光标行为 2022-02-24 21:14:22 +08:00
Xu Liu
ce99c0f15b feat: 允许弹出开始菜单,自动处理光标的捕获和释放 2022-02-24 17:48:15 +08:00
刘旭
cba4c65990 [WIP] 优化光标 2022-02-23 17:25:48 +08:00
Xu Liu
c860bde1ff feat: 实现效果渲染 2022-02-22 23:03:21 +08:00
Xu Liu
56a9ace069 fix: 修复DPI缩放相关问题 2022-02-20 16:48:32 +08:00
Xu Liu
36e3839caa feat: 实现绘制光标
最后一个效果的最后一个 Pass 负责绘制光标,大概可以提高性能
2022-02-20 15:54:00 +08:00
刘旭
9660416b86 feat: 改变隐藏光标的方式 2021-09-08 12:14:29 +08:00
Xu Liu
c3304074dd 优化架构 2021-05-04 22:56:27 +08:00